What will the weather in Mitchellville be like during my vacation?
July and August are typically the warmest months in Mitchellville when the average temp is 75°F. January and February are the coldest months when the average temperature is 40°F. July and June are the months with the most rain.

Best time to go to Mitchellville

Mitchellville experiences its lowest average temperature in January, at 34.7°F (1.5°C), while July is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 79.2°F (26.2°C). July is usually the wettest month. April, May, and July are the peak travel months in Mitchellville, attracting a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is mostly sunny, with light rainfall. On the other hand, January, November, and December tend to be quieter times to visit, marked by light rainfall and mostly sunny conditions.
